## Gatewick Rate Limiting — Provenance Notes

Hey, welcome aboard! The rate limiter in Gatewick (our internal API gateway) ships from the Tollbrook pipeline, and every build gets a provenance stamp. Before you test throttle rules, make sure your sandbox is running a stamped build, not a local hack. The current verified build token is listed below.

pipeline stamp: htk31_f769b577b3028a4e9958e5bb8d1259a

Onboarding note for the Ledgerpane admin table: bulk edits are applied through the batcher service, not directly against the database. Select rows, choose an action, and the batcher stages changes in a pending set you can review before commit. Edits over 500 rows require a second approver — this is enforced server-side, so don't try to chunk around it. To run the batcher locally you need the staging write credential, which goes in your .env as the next line.

secret setting of bahip-kagag: RELAY_SECRET3=c83

## Changelog — Ticktrace 1.9

### Renamed: DRIFT_API_TOKEN
During the cron drift investigation we found plugins confusing this variable with the metrics token, so it has been renamed to indicate it authorizes drift-report uploads specifically. Plugin authors must read the new name from 1.9 onward; the old name is ignored without warning. Sample env files in the SDK are updated. In your deployment env file, the drift-report upload secret is set on the next line.

env line for fawef-taguf: VAULT_KEY13=a9695905a9a90